Completely understand – I agree with the shipping of ZWP products first argument bc yes, that was unexpected and made me pretty upset too. Regarding Inovelli’s orders though, I can see the argument of shipping anyone who ordered 1 switch together, anyone who ordered 2 switches together, etc bc if they went in the order the orders were placed, they may be more prone to errors (also costing them money).

In other words, 1 switch orders have a specific box that’s used (more like a bubble sleeve) whereas 2 switches have another box, 3 switches another box, etc.

If we start mixing orders, things can get out of order quickly if you’re not paying attention.

Again, I’m not saying this is the right way to go about it, this is just what was explained to me.
